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a CPR Manikin
1. Durability: Built to Last Through Rigorous Training
Medical training programs often involve frequent, hands-on practice, so durability is a top priority. A CPR manikin should withstand repeated use without compromising its functionality. Look for models made from high-quality materials like vinyl plastic over polyurethane foam, which are known for their resilience.
For EMS professionals who may train in varied environments—such as outdoor settings or on rough surfaces—durability is even more critical. A robust manikin ensures longevity, saving you from frequent replacements. 2. Realism: Simulating Real-Life Scenarios
Realism in a CPR manikin is vital for effective training. Manikins that closely mimic human anatomy and responses help trainees build confidence in their skills. Features to look for include:
  • Lifelike chest rise and recoil: This simulates the feel of real chest compressions and ventilations.
  • Anatomical landmarks: Look for manikins with realistic sternum, ribcage, and airway structures.
  • Adjustable airway resistance: This allows trainees to practice managing different patient conditions.
For advanced training, such as ALS scenarios, manikins with additional features like pulse points or the ability to simulate complications (e.g., difficult airways) can enhance the learning experience. Realism ensures that trainees are better prepared to handle diverse patient demographics, from infants to adults.
3. Feedback Mechanisms: Improving CPR Quality
Feedback mechanisms are a game-changer in CPR training. They provide real-time data on compression depth, rate, and hand placement, helping trainees refine their technique. Many modern CPR manikins come equipped with:
  • Audible cues: A clicking sound to indicate correct compression depth.
  • Visual indicators: LED lights or monitors that show if compressions are at the right rate (100–120 per minute, per AHA guidelines).
  • Bluetooth-enabled feedback: Some advanced models connect to apps for detailed performance metrics.
Feedback is especially important for professional training programs, as it ensures trainees meet industry standards. For example, the American Heart Association emphasizes the importance of feedback devices in improving CPR quality, as they help students deliver consistent, high-quality compressions.
4. Portability and Ease of Use
For training centers that conduct sessions at multiple locations, portability is a key consideration. Lightweight manikins that are easy to assemble, disassemble, and transport can save time and effort. Additionally, manikins should be easy to clean between uses—a critical factor for maintaining hygiene, especially in group training settings.
5. Training Level: Basic vs. Advanced
The type of training you’re conducting will determine the features you need in a CPR manikin:
  • Basic CPR Training: For community CPR courses or introductory classes, a simple manikin with basic feedback (e.g., audible clicks for compression depth) may suffice.
  • Advanced CPR Training: For EMS professionals or medical schools teaching ALS, you’ll need manikins with advanced features like airway management, defibrillation compatibility, and detailed feedback systems.

Additional Considerations for CPR Manikin Selection
  • Diversity and Inclusivity: Look for manikins available in different skin tones to create an inclusive training environment. At EMRN, we offer diversity kits with manikins in medium and dark skin tones, ensuring all trainees feel represented.
  • Warranty and Support: Check the warranty period for your manikin. For example, Prestan manikins typically come with a 3-year limited warranty, while Laerdal models often have robust support options.
  • Accessories and Compatibility: Ensure the manikin is compatible with AED trainers and other accessories you may already use in your program.
